I am trying to go to an event here with a group of friends, maybe 4-5 people. I want to buy standard camping tickets and I am curious on how many tickets I will need to purches? Is there a limit on how many people can be in one camp spot?

It is one ticket per vehicle. And if you want to be camping together you need to follow each other into the campground because they put you in single file.

If u all go in together like in an RV or all in 1 car, it's the same price. We had an rv with 3 of us and a friend from Montana who came the second day in his own car and we paid the flat 180 for 2 days of camping for the 4 of us.
